He had persuaded himself that his love for Claudia could be nothing but the outcome of a natural bond between them that must produce a like feeling in her.

He had attributed to her the depth and intensity of emotion that he found in himself.

He had seen in her not merely a girl of more than common quickness, and perhaps more than common capacity, but a great nature ready to respond to a great passion in another.

She had much to give to the man she loved; but Stafford asked even more than was hers to bestow.

He had deceived himself, and the delusion was still upon him.
